October 3 News Today, former NBA player Richard Jefferson talked about Westbrook on the podcast "RoadTrippin".
Talking about Westbrook's current situation, Jefferson said: "I will always remember my twelfth season of my career. I was troubled by a back injury and fell out of the rotation lineup at the Golden State Warriors. My high school friends made a special trip to watch the ball. They have never seen me on the bench since the sixth grade. I still remember that feeling fresh."
"You really need time to adapt. I didn't experience this situation for the first time until I was 32 years old. That psychological impact is simply indescribable. It is this darkest moment that makes people sober. Will you start to examine what is really important? Do you want to retire with a decent attitude? Or are you willing to pay any price for purely loving basketball? We have witnessed too many legendary players going through such a mental journey. The key is whether you can cross the psychological level of 'cognitive reconstruction'." Jefferson said.
